Understanding Category B Driving License
A Category B driving license, frequently described as a cars and truck driving license, is a license that permits the holder to drive lorries such as cars, little vans, and small trucks. This category is among the most common and necessary licenses for everyday driving needs. It is especially essential for people who need to commute to work, run errands, or travel for leisure.
Eligibility Requirements
Before you can get a Category B driving license, you should fulfill specific eligibility requirements. These requirements might differ slightly depending upon the country or region, however generally consist of:
Age: Most countries require applicants to be at least 17 years old to get a student's authorization and 18 years of ages to obtain a full license.Residency: You must be a resident of the country or area where you are getting the license.Medical Fitness: You must be in health and meet the minimum vision requirements. Some countries might require a medical exam to confirm your physical fitness to drive.Student's Permit: In numerous locations, you need to hold a student's permit for a particular period before you can take the useful driving test.Actions to Obtain a Category B Driving License
Make an application for a Learner's Permit
Paperwork: Gather the essential files, such as your identification, evidence of address, and a medical certificate if required.Application: Fill out the application and send it to the pertinent authority, such as the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or the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ency (DVLA).Theory Test: Pass the theory test, which usually covers road rules, traffic indications, and safe driving practices.
Practice Driving
Monitored Driving: Practice driving under the guidance of a licensed chauffeur who is at least 21 years old and has actually held a complete license for a minimum of 3 years.Driving Lessons: Consider taking professional driving lessons to improve your abilities and confidence. Numerous driving schools offer structured programs that cover all aspects of safe driving.
Take the Practical Driving Test
Test Preparation: Familiarize yourself with the test route and practice the required maneuvers, such as parallel parking, turning, and emergency stops.Test Day: Arrive on time with the required documents, such as your student's license, identification, and the lorry you will be utilizing for the test.Test Evaluation: The inspector will examine your ability to drive securely and follow traffic rules. You may be asked to carry out particular maneuvers and show your knowledge of roadway signs and signals.
Get the Full License
Pass the Test: If you pass the practical driving test, you will be provided a provisional full license.License Validity: The validity period of the license might vary, however it is usually legitimate for several years before it needs to be restored.Extra ConsiderationsInsurance: Ensure that you have legitimate car insurance before you start driving. A lot of countries need motorists to have at least third-party liability insurance.Car Requirements: Make sure the vehicle you are utilizing for the test is roadworthy and meets all legal requirements, such as having a legitimate MOT certificate (in the UK) or passing a vehicle assessment (in other nations).Driving Restrictions: Some nations might enforce restrictions on brand-new drivers, such as a curfew or a limitation on the number of passengers they can bring. Understand these limitations and follow them to avoid charges.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
